"Shinigami" is one of the representative works of classic rakugo created by the master, Sanyutei Encho, based on Grim's fairy tales. It has been beloved for over 100 years as an easy-to-understand and entertaining piece. At the same time, various interpretations of Shinigami can emerge depending on the performer, making the diversity of presentation styles an attractive story.
